      Just a thought. How come there are West African Manatees in captivity only in China and Japan? Or are there more?
    • Jihoon Lee
      Currently without Africa, there are 4 places in the world that we can see them, which are Toba aquarium in Japan (1 M, 2 F), COEX aquarium in South Korea (2 M, 1 F), Hangzhou aquarium in China(1 M, 1 F), Hualian ocean park in Taiwan (2 M). But I can't clearly say that these are the only places we could see West African Manatees, because many aquariums and zoos in the world are trying to get this species nowadays.

      And the aquariums in Yantai and Penglai also have six individuals in total. But it seems that there is no breeding plan in China now. All the west African manatees in China are from Cameroon.
      Beijing Zoo used to import a pair of West Indian manatees from Mexico, and they bred thrice. But now they all died :(

      Chimelong Ocean World in Zhuhai City, Guangdong Province, has a group of seven West African manatees in a huge fresh-water exhibit with a style similar to Singapore's River Safari, but has a underwater tunnel additionally. You can see their manatee exhibit in this webcam:
